Transaction 60e154c41a2432a057a76fa696118d050d8ee1eb812aa26c4d704784018433b6
1 Input
1 Output
-
60e154c41a2432a057a76fa696118d050d8ee1eb812aa26c4d704784018433b6:0
- value
- 29303742
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d2608d14e1210c867b1fd0712a07a99cd0855f19 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LBNZmoQ3ondQ2h1muVHK3nxUjxaREenj7